Recreating Retro Anime OP with MiniMax H3: 15-min Generation on RTX 5090
GamerVick · reddit · 2026-08-09
A creator shared a workflow using the MiniMax H3 model to produce a retro Japanese anime-style opening sequence (inspired by Naruto). The process combines multi-image references, a structured reference-video timeline, and music from Suno, achieving a stylized graphic noir/jazz aesthetic.
The author also highlighted a local inference bottleneck: generating a 15-second 720p video takes about 15 minutes on an RTX 5090 with 64GB RAM. Despite enabling sol attention and sage attention optimizations, the speed remains a hurdle. The creator avoided Turbo LoRA to prevent quality degradation and asked the community for further speed-up solutions.
